The impact of websites like Tamilyogi on the film industry is profound and destructive. The entertainment industry in India is estimated to lose billions of rupees every year to digital piracy, with one report suggesting losses of around INR 224 billion (approx. $2.7 billion) annually. While this figure encompasses various forms of piracy, sites like Tamilyogi are a significant contributor. These financial losses directly affect everyone involved in the filmmaking process, from the biggest stars to the technicians, spot boys, and other crew members who rely on a film's box office success and legal streaming revenue for their livelihoods. By choosing to watch a film through illegal means, one actively participates in undermining the industry and discouraging future investments in creative content.
